After seeing his professor in an interview on the show nightline, the author is reminded of a promise he made sixteen years ago to keep in touch with him.

The story was later adapted by thomas rickman into a tv movie of the same name directed by mick jackson, which aired on 5 december 1999 and starred jack lemmon and hank azaria. Oprah winfrey produced a major television movie for abc based on tuesdays with morrie that aired in 1999 and won four emmy awards in 2000. Mitch first met morrie while majoring in music at brandeis university where morrie taught classes in sociology.
